Territorial Police Command in Kampala Metropolitan Police (KMP) South and KMP East conducted a series of intelligence-led disruptive operations between the 28th and 29th of October 2025, targeting criminal elements and areas notorious for drug abuse, robbery and theft.
In Kampala Central Division, 40 suspects were rounded up in black spots linked to theft of motor vehicle parts and other street crimes. In Kira Municipality (Kitukutwe, Kiwologoma, Kungu, Buwate and Najjera), seven suspects were arrested with suspected narcotics and a toy gun suspected to be used in robberies.

In Kajjansi Division, 45 suspects were apprehended from Ngobe, Sseguku and Kajjansi for suspected involvement in early-morning robberies. In Mukono, a joint operation in Kyugu and Kisenyi–Degeya led to the arrest of nine suspects found with suspected narcotic substances .

All suspects are detained at respective stations pending screening and prosecution. Police will continue with intelligence-led operations to dismantle criminal networks and enhance public safety across the metropolitan area.
